CUMBERLAND COUNTY, Pa. — The Upper Allen Township Park Passport is both a guide and a challenge for families interested in being more active over the summer.

It also celebrates the 175th anniversary of the township.

The passport was made in partnership with the company Bandwango.

Launched in May of this year, more than 400 people have already signed up for the pass.

“We always hope that this is a lifestyle change, we want kids and parents and families in the township to be healthy; a lot of people know about our key parks like Fischer, Friendship and Winding Hill, but what we’re really doing with this pass is drawing them into some of the other parks that we have that they may not know about,” said assistant township manager, Tim Wendling.

The pass is free to sign up, does not require an app to download and can be accessed through the Upper Allen Township website.

People visit fourteen parks and build points every visit, which can be redeemed for prizes like a T-shirt or lightsaber.

“As long as you’re within a quarter of a mile, you can hit the check-in button and your GPS checks it in automatically and then it keeps track for you as you go throughout the summer,” Wendling said. “You can only check in once throughout all the parks and get all the prizes, it is a onetime thing, but it is really easy to just go to the park and check in, spend some time there, and go to the next park the next day.”

Although the initiative targets families with children, anyone can sign up and take advantage of the passport.

People have until Aug. 15 to visit the parks and earn points. All prizes redeemed must be picked up at the Upper Allen Township building.
